Output 38520f03a8c60809a189f06958ad7feb983d6bece14b9328462fa84e3ec66db6:0

value
9973894
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d54fbc2e64eba04525693ac5251b980c0dc14a2 OP_EQUALVERIFY OP_CHECKSIG
address
1FLttsVLBwjCdrFmuEEJnduX2kh3cteqqe
transaction
38520f03a8c60809a189f06958ad7feb983d6bece14b9328462fa84e3ec66db6
spent
true